(1):

(v. t.) To thrust out or eject; to expel; as, to exclude young animals from the womb or from eggs.

(2):

(v. t.) To shut out; to hinder from entrance or admission; to debar from participation or enjoyment; to deprive of; to except; - the opposite to admit; as, to exclude a crowd from a room or house; to exclude the light; to exclude one nation from the ports of another; to exclude a taxpayer from the privilege of voting.
